Building Hybrid Handheld Software

The rise of smartphones has made hybrid mobile applications increasingly popular . These systems allow creators to generate a unified codebase that works across several environments, such as iOS and Android devices. The perks are substantial, including reduced development costs , faster time-to-market, and wider audience reach. However, drawbacks do exist . These can involve potential limitations in exploiting native features, responsiveness worries , and fixing intricate code. Fortunately, a number of frameworks are available to assist this undertaking . These include frameworks like Facebook's framework, Flutter , and Microsoft’s platform .

  • Minimized coding expenses
  • More rapid time-to-market
  • Wider user base
  • Possible limitations with device-specific features

Selecting the Right System for Hybrid- Platform Applications

Creating portable software for multiple devices is a difficult process. Selecting a best tool is crucial for achievement. Options like React Native, Flutter, and Xamarin deliver unique upsides – React Native permits leveraging existing JavaScript skills, Flutter boasts outstanding performance, while Xamarin provides native control to device features. Thoroughly evaluate the project's specific requirements and team's skills to make an informed selection.
